Sparse domination for singular integral operators and their commutators in Dunkl setting with applications

Abstract

In this paper, we establish sparse dominations for the Dunkl-Calder\'on-Zygmund operators and their commutators in the Dunkl setting. As applications, we first define the Dunkl-Muckenhoupt Ap weight and obtain the weighted bounds for the Dunkl-Calder\'on-Zygmund operators, as well as the two-weight bounds for their commutators. Moreover, we also obtain the boundedness of the Dunkl-Calder\'on-Zygmund operators on the extrapolation space of a family of Banach function spaces.
